78a07d708db1b400962c9a1cb36df005.ppt
- Количество слайдов: 18
Ongoing Research P. Krishna Reddy IIIT, Hyderabad pkreddy@iiit. ac. in COMAD 2008
Core Database Systems: Transaction Management • So far – Transaction management • Database systems • Replicated databases • Current work – Speculative locking
Speculative Locking: Example T 1 releases lock on X T 1 completes work on X T 1: T 2: r 1[X] w 1[X'] r 1[Y] w 1[Y'] s 1 e 1 c 1 r 2[X] w 2[X'] r 2[Z] w 2[Z'] s 2 e 2 (i) 2 PL T 1: T 2: r 1[X] w 1[X'] r 1[Y] w 1[Y'] s 1 s 2 e 1 T 21 r 2[X'] w 2[X"'] r 2[Z] w 2[Z"] time c 1 r 2[X] w 2[X"] r 2[Z] w 2[Z'] T 22 c 2 (ii) SL e 2 c 2 time Speculation trades extra processing power for performance
Core Database Systems • Current work – Speculation to improve the performance of read-only transactions • Future: – Investigate how low cost CPU/main memory CLOUD to improve application and system parallelism and build • speculative operating systems. • Speculative transaction managers • Speculative web service managers
Data and Web data mining • Extraction of rare knowledge – Rare association rules • Improve search quality by extending ideas from social networks and other domains. • Recommend products which for every Indian consumer. • Create an online facility to retrieve similar judgements for lawyers and judges and reduce justice delivery period.
Data and Web data mining • User interfaces – Designing efficient data entry framework – to help e-commerce customers to reduce the time to select the product • Text mining – Exploit web directories for better text mining.
ICTs for Social Development • Through e. Sagu, make every Indian farmer to produce 100% export quality farm produce and increase income in the order of magnitude.
Sample Photographs 2
Sample Photographs 3
Sample advices generated by Agricultural Externs
ICTs for Social Development ICTs-based Agricultural Education • Existing framework – Agricultural experts visit land learns the applied concepts • Proposed framework: – AEs learn practical knowledge by exposing themselves with huge number of farm situations captured under ICT-based learning framework – The farm situations are captured and indexed using ICTs such as data warehousing, image processing, video, and audio.
ICTs for Social Development ICTs-based Agricultural Education • We have announced Post-graduate Diploma in applied agriculture and IT (PGDAAIT) – Similar to House surgeon course for MBBS students. • The ICT-based learning framework has three components – Data warehouse of crop care concepts (DWOC 3) – e. Sagu Clinic – Field visits
ICTs for Social Development ICTs-based Agricultural Education • DWOC 3 contains – Data warehouse of virtual farm observation concepts which are captured through multimedia data including text, photos, video, audio. – DWOC 3 contains farm situations indexed based on various concepts in a multidimensional manner.
ICTs for Social Development ICTs-based Agricultural Education • In e. Sagu. Clinic, – a group of scientists deliver the agricultural advice based on the crop status information received in the form of digital photos and other information. – For PGDAAIT program, we will operate few e. Sagu local centers. – The students are exposed to e. Sagu. Clinic to learn the practical aspects. • Field visits – The students are exposed to field visits.
ICTs for Social Development Build farmer ERP • Formal Problem Statement: Given – – – a region (say r 1, r 2…rl) , number of farms (f 1, f 2…fm), types of soil of each form (s 1, s 2…sn), crop grown in each farm (c 1, c 2…co), variety of the crop (v 1, v 2…vp), weather type (w 1, w 2…wq), water availability (wa 1, wa 2…war), labor availability (la 1, la 2…las), machines (c 1, c 2…cu) the farmer can invest (m 1, m 2…mt) and the type of market where his products can be sold. • Find the problems that can occur in the farms of a farmer, in various stages of crop cultivation. • Come up with an optimized plan for all the farms of a farmer, so that the magnitude of the problems can be reduced. Problem 6.
ICTs for Social Development Improving Literacy • Build an IT-based system to provide functional literacy (read, write, simple maths) to each and every illiterate in India without disturbing his/her daily routine (earning source or power).
78a07d708db1b400962c9a1cb36df005.ppt